It's because Jaguar doesn't have the everything-on-one-screen thing of the 
native Perseus software nor the menu+pulldowns of SDR Console.

Rather, you have to memorize some keyboard shortcuts to call up the function 
you want. All that appears when you run the software isa Jaguar icon at the 
bottom of the screen.


Caveat: I haven't played with the full Jaguar software in many years. I doubt 
it has changed in terms of user interface as the scheme is considered to be a 
philosophical basis of the product. I think this was a rejection of the old 
fashioned way to structure a product, but the baby was thrown out with the bath 
water.
